Independent production company brings back popular music, light and astronomy shows to Burnaby.
A Vancouver-based independent production company is making a stellar comeback with its long-running laser, light and astronomy shows after a three-year hiatus due to the pandemic.
The shows include video with lasers, analog and digital star projections in 360 degrees and a full Led Zeppelin concert in surround sound — all choreographed live in the planetarium dome. Other show highlights include an immersive laser show for Pink Floyd’s Dark Side of the Moon and music by Gorillaz.
